(2) JEDEC document JEP157 states that 250-V CDM allows safe manufacturing with a standard ESD control process. 7.2 ESD Ratings VALUE UNIT V(ESD) Electrostatic discharge Human-body model (HBM), per ANSI/ESDA/JEDEC JS-001(1) ±1500 V Charged-device model (CDM), per JEDEC specification JESD22- C101(2) ±500 (1) Logic operational for HS of –11 V to +600 V at HB–HS = 15 V 7.3 Recommended Operating Conditions All voltages are with respect to COM, over operating free-air temperature range (unless otherwise noted) MIN NOM MAX UNIT VDD Supply voltage IGBT applications 10 20 V MOSFET applications 10 17 HB–HS Driver bootstrap voltage IGBT applications 10 20 MOSFET applications 10 17 HS Source terminal voltage(1) –11 600 HI, LI Input voltage with respect to COM –4 20 TA Ambient temperature –40 125 °C (1) For more information about traditional and new thermal metrics, see the Semiconductor and IC Package Thermal Metrics application report, SPRA953. 7.4 Thermal Information THERMAL METRIC(1) UCC27712 UNIT (SOIC) 8 PINS RθJA Junction-to-ambient thermal resistance 108.3 °C/W RθJC(top) Junction-to-case (top) thermal resistance 61.5 °C/W RθJB Junction-to-board thermal resistance 57.9 °C/W ψJT Junction-to-top characterization parameter 15.3 °C/W ψJB Junction-to-board characterization parameter 57.2 °C/W 7.5 Electrical Characteristics At VDD = VHB = 15 V, COM = VHS = 0, all voltages are with respect to COM, no load on LO and HO, –40°C < TJ < +125°C (unless otherwise noted). Currents are positive into and negative out of the specified terminal. PARAMETER TEST CONDITIONS MIN TYP MAX UNIT SUPPLY BLOCK VVDD ON Turn-on threshold voltage of VDD 8.0 8.9 9.8 V VVDD OFF Turn-off threshold voltage of VDD 7.5 8.4 9.3 VVDD HYS Hysteresis of VDD 0.5 VVHB ON Turn-on threshold voltage of VHB–VHS 7.2 8.2 9.2 VVHB OFF Turn-off threshold voltage of VHB–VHS 6.4 7.3 8.3 VVHB HYS Hysteresis of VHB–VHS 0.5 0.9 |
